Size: 3.5 fl. oz. Directions: Wash with your favorite shampoo. Be sure not to use a conditioner or conditioning shampoo. Completely dry hair and scalp. Hair dryer may be used. Brush or comb hair to be sure it is free of any tangles or knots, leaving bald or thinning spots exposed. Apply Hair Color Thickener to the area by holding can nozzle about four inches away and spraying until the hair and skin tone match. Spray the hair around the thinning area and blend. Allow area to dry and repeat if necessary until desired coverage is achieved. When hair and scalp are completely dry, use a coarse brush and very gently brush hair into place over thinning area. Your newly sprayed hair and scalp gives the illusion of a thicker, fuller head of hair.

I have had great luck with this product. I am a 50 year old female with medium-to-dark brown hair that I wear in a bob and part on the side. My hair has thinned in the front just above my forehead (next to the part at the crown) so that my white scalp was showing through. I bought this product plus two of the powder/fiber type products to try. I am by far the happiest with the Jerome Russell medium brown spray. It is easy to apply and I did not find that it makes a mess. I also sweat a lot and have had no problems with that. I swim several times a week and you can't tell that I have sprayed my hair. It just isn't an issue. It also has not rubbed off at all on my pillow case. Maybe I am not having problems because I am not trying to cover a large spot. But the two small areas I am covering were very noticeable to me and I am grateful to have found a product that adds volume and color and takes away all the self consciousness I was feeling.
